Beşiktaş İskele, a historic landmark in Istanbul, serves as a vibrant hub that connects locals and tourists alike to the breathtaking beauty of the Bosphorus. This charming dock is not only a place of transit but also a cultural hotspot, surrounded by cafes, shops, and bustling streets filled with life. As you stroll along the waterfront, the picturesque views of the water and the city skyline create an enchanting backdrop perfect for photography enthusiasts. The area is known for its lively atmosphere, especially during the evenings when the sunset casts a golden hue over the waters. Visitors can enjoy watching ferries come and go, transporting passengers to various destinations across the Bosphorus. The proximity to Beşiktaş's vibrant neighborhood means that you can easily explore local dining options and shops, making it an ideal starting point for your adventures in Istanbul. History enthusiasts will appreciate the significance of Beşiktaş İskele, which has been an important maritime point in the city's past. This blend of historical importance and modern-day charm makes Beşiktaş İskele a must-visit for anyone looking to capture the essence of Istanbul. Whether you're enjoying a quiet moment by the water or immersing yourself in the lively local culture, Beşiktaş İskele promises an unforgettable experience.
